    The "High end Talent Access Plan" is a 2-year visa issued by the Hong Kong government for high paying, educated, and experienced talents to facilitate their exploration in Hong Kong and make up for the lack of talent in industries and professions in Hong Kong. Spouses and unmarried dependent children under the age of 18 can also go to Hong Kong.

    The Outstanding Talents Admission Scheme is a talent introduction program launched by the Hong Kong government in 2006. Intended to attract high-tech or outstanding talents with good educational backgrounds to settle in Hong Kong, in order to enhance Hong Kong's competitiveness in the global market.

    In 2024, Hong Kong once again extended an olive branch to global investors and launched a new "New Capital Investment Entrant Scheme". This new policy aims to attract high net worth individuals from around the world to invest in Hong Kong, promote diversified economic development, and enrich its talent pool.
